In East York (City of Toronto), curtain wall installation demand is driven mainly by medical and professional office fit-out, retail and plaza renovation, institutional and community buildings, and light industrial conversion. East York's construction market runs on renewal rather than new building, concentrated along the Danforth and through the Leaside and Overlea employment pockets.
A growing share is industrial buildings being converted to office, studio and clinic use, which brings structural and servicing questions the original building never anticipated. Activity clusters in the Danforth commercial corridor, the Overlea and Thorncliffe business area, the Leaside employment lands, and the Coxwell institutional cluster.
